Transaction 621829e0719de838c7fc23b72f4ba08114512e06bbaabc1f7ecfb61f7572b599

4 Input
2 Outputs
  • 621829e0719de838c7fc23b72f4ba08114512e06bbaabc1f7ecfb61f7572b599:0
  • value  1337632
    address  15Pw1KHdHCpDEPCscsddPNbddZZD9wft7A
  • 621829e0719de838c7fc23b72f4ba08114512e06bbaabc1f7ecfb61f7572b599:1
  • value  10877270
    address  1K37RXT3VQXPQM92kTfJBPmoygdZNaV56t